  • Boxes That Look Like a Cake
  • From "Embellish This!"
    episode DEMB-201


    PHOTO

    Although it looks like a cake, host Dena Fishbein proves that it's actually a creative way to wrap your gifts.
    Materials --

    1 set of unfinished round cardboard boxes: small, medium and large
    Silk flowers
    Pink rose buds
    Off white tulle
    Off white pom-pom fringe trim
    Scissors
    Hot glue gun
    Hot glue sticks
    Black Sharpie Permanent Markers with an Ultra Fine Point
    Design Master Spray Paint -- Perfect Pink

    1. Spray paint the boxes. Let dry.

      Safety Tip: Spray the boxes outside in a well-ventilated area.

    2. Write messages on the box lids and draw scallops at the bottom of the boxes (figure A) with the permanent marker.

    3. Measure pom-pom trim around each box lid and cut to size. Glue pom-pom trim around box lids with hot glue gun, gluing in sections (figure B).

    4. Measure tulle around each box bottom plus enough to tie a knot and cut. Tie in place. Fluff the ends of the tulle coming out of the knot. This will be your bow. Cut the excess.

    5. Attach rose buds to the center of the tulle bow (figure C) with a hot glue gun.

    6. Assemble flower piece and hot glue on top of a small box for a nice finished look.

    7. Line each box with tissue paper and fill each box with a special treat -- i.e. candies, cookies, jewelry, etc. (figure D) that your recipient will love.
